A digital electronic universal computer is a type of computer that processes information in binary form (using digits 0 and 1) and can perform a wide variety of tasks by executing programmed instructions.

In the modern world, technology has become an integral part of our daily lives. One of the most significant advancements in this realm is the invention of the digital electronic universal computer. This term refers to a type of computer that can process data in digital form, using electronic circuits and capable of performing a wide range of tasks. The importance of the digital electronic universal computer cannot be overstated, as it has revolutionized the way we work, communicate, and entertain ourselves.The concept of a computer dates back to the early 20th century, but it was not until the development of electronic components that computers became practical for everyday use. The digital electronic universal computer emerged as a result of combining these electronic components with digital technology, allowing for faster processing speeds and more complex calculations. This innovation paved the way for the modern computing era, where we rely on computers for everything from simple calculations to complex simulations.One of the defining characteristics of the digital electronic universal computer is its versatility. Unlike earlier machines, which were designed for specific tasks, this type of computer can perform a wide array of functions. For instance, it can be used for word processing, graphic design, data analysis, and even gaming. This universality is a key factor in its widespread adoption across various fields, including education, business, healthcare, and entertainment.Moreover, the digital electronic universal computer has transformed the way we communicate. With the advent of the internet, computers have become essential tools for connecting people across the globe. Email, social media, and video conferencing are just a few examples of how these machines have changed the landscape of communication. The ability to share information instantly has made the world a smaller place, fostering collaboration and innovation on an unprecedented scale.In addition to communication, the digital electronic universal computer has also impacted industries significantly. In healthcare, for instance, computers are used for patient record management, diagnostic imaging, and even robotic surgeries. In business, they facilitate operations, enhance productivity, and provide data-driven insights that inform decision-making. The influence of the digital electronic universal computer extends to scientific research as well, where it aids in data collection, analysis, and simulation of complex systems.Despite its many benefits, the rise of the digital electronic universal computer also presents challenges. Issues such as data privacy, cybersecurity, and the digital divide highlight the need for responsible usage and equitable access to technology. As we continue to integrate computers into every aspect of our lives, it is crucial to address these concerns to ensure that the advantages of the digital electronic universal computer are accessible to everyone.In conclusion, the digital electronic universal computer represents a monumental leap in technology that has reshaped our world in countless ways. Its ability to process information digitally, perform a variety of tasks, and facilitate global communication has made it an indispensable tool in contemporary society. As we look to the future, it is essential to harness the power of the digital electronic universal computer responsibly, ensuring that its benefits are shared widely while addressing the challenges it brings. The journey of technological advancement continues, and the digital electronic universal computer will undoubtedly play a pivotal role in shaping the future.
